Overall Meaning

The lyrics of "All Hope Is Gone" by Jacks of All Trades are a call to action for people who have lost hope and faith in themselves. The singer promises to help revive their lost spirits by giving them the words to put things back into focus. According to the lyrics, he is not a "soul assassin," but rather, he is someone who can bring your soul back to life. The song suggests that by allowing the Holy Ghost in, a person can get rid of their sins and find hope again.


The song has a clear message of redemption, urging people to make positive changes before it's too late. The imagery of imagining one's soul being thrown into a black hole emphasizes the urgency of the message. The songwriters are calling for people to take control of their lives and avoid descending into darkness. The chorus emphasizes the importance of hope and the powerful effect it has on the human soul. The song ends on a somber note, implying that without hope, all is lost.
